Syrian winners at Arab Collegiate Programming Contest in Egypt honored

Cairo, SANA – The Syrian Businessmen gathering in Egypt on Wednesday held a ceremony to honor Syrian students participating in the Arab Collegiate Programming Contest held in Egypt.

Three Syrian teams have qualified to the int’l Collegiate Programming Contest in China according to the results of regional Collegiate Programming Contest (ACPC) being held in Sharm El-Sheikh last week with the participation of 600 students representing 16 states.

Speaking during the ceremony, Head of the Syrian consular mission in Egypt, Riyad Sneih, said that the Syrian student delegation proved the creativity of Syrians.

Other speakers saw in the Syrian students’ achievement a message on Syrian people’s steadfastness and ability to innovate, compete and contribute to the shaping of their future despite the terrorist war waged on them.
